| 148170 | 2003-05-28 16:15:00 | I got this "keyboard Power On" option in the BIOS Does this mean i can turn the PC on by using the keyboard? Cheers |
neptune (3819) | ||
| 148171 | 2003-05-28 21:13:00 | if your keyboard is ps2 and has a power key then yes. from what i have seen this function wont work with USB keyboards even if they have a power button because USB needs the system to be powered up to work. try it and see what happens. |
robsonde (120) | ||
| 148172 | 2003-05-29 01:04:00 | Well my keyboard is PS2 It doesnt have a power Button. In the BIOS it gives option of changing the power key to something else. Like to some other key on keyboard. I tried it, does not work. Maybe it has to do something with power supply. |
neptune (3819) | ||
| 148173 | 2003-05-29 05:35:00 | It would need to be an ATX power supply. An AT switches the mains, ATX uses logic levels to control the switchmode parts. | Graham L (2) | ||
